First of all it's a really nice piece of homoerotic art (heh). However, if you really want specifik anatomical critiques I would probably point out the hip area in comparison to the shoulderwidth.
His/yours lower body looks a little too small for that upper body: If you bend your leg up towards your head (align it with your upper body) your knee will almost align in height with your shoulder. However, even though perspective is taken into account, his legs look somewhat too small for that act. Even though, they go good together with the rest of his lower body/groin, so my 2 cents would be that his pelvis+legs would need to be a size or two bigger. I think it was mostly the thin waistline that leads into a small pelvis that created the problem in the first place.
I wouldn't rework it on this one, but instead recommend remembering it for your upcoming homoerotic projects. :> |
